Output ad640689bc06a841ed696e4b5826c44e9f4fb676fc3c632e31cd97237a3e3ef1:0

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 18b577d3621381c271d57e2cb952f2a56d337452
address
bc1qrz6h05mzzwquyuw40cktj5hj54knxazj988ru7
transaction
ad640689bc06a841ed696e4b5826c44e9f4fb676fc3c632e31cd97237a3e3ef1
spent
true